Zero Waste Personal Care Essentials

Reusable Hygiene Products:

  • Bamboo toothbrushes
  • Safety razors
  • Menstrual cups
  • Reusable cotton rounds
  • Cloth makeup remover pads

Sustainable Toiletry Alternatives:

  • Shampoo and conditioner bars
  • Solid deodorant
  • Package-free soap
  • Tooth tablets
  • Natural loofah alternatives

Sustainable Bathroom Product Swaps

Disposable Item Alternatives:

  • Reusable cotton swabs
  • Biodegradable dental floss
  • Cloth makeup wipes
  • Metal safety razors
  • Washable shower loofahs

Natural Material Replacements:

  • Bamboo toothbrushes
  • Wooden hair combs
  • Natural fiber washcloths
  • Hemp shower towels
  • Silk dental floss
